Fallen branch damages car and injures motorcyclist in Hanoi

A large tree branch fell on Le Trong Tan Street (Phuong Liet ward) during a thunderstorm, striking a parked car and a motorcyclist.

Around 12:30 PM on 14/8, a delivery driver on a motorbike was hit by the falling branch. Bystanders helped the victim to his feet; he suffered only minor scratches. A parked car was also hit by the branch but sustained minimal damage.

At the time, heavy rain and strong winds were reported. The fallen branch appeared to be decaying. Authorities removed the branch from the scene by 1:30 PM.

Starting at 11:45 AM, dark clouds gathered over Hanoi, followed by a thunderstorm lasting over an hour. This led to localized flooding in several streets, including Tan Mai, Trieu Khuc, and Yen Xa. The Northern Meteorological and Hydrological Center forecast that within the next 1-3 hours, Hanoi and surrounding areas would continue to experience moderate to heavy rain, with rainfall between 20-40 mm and higher in some areas.

The National Center for Hydro-Meteorological Forecasting stated that from 14/8 to 18/8, Hanoi will continue to have thunderstorms, with moderate to heavy rain possible from 15/8 to 17/8. Temperatures are expected to range from 30-33 degrees Celsius. From 19/8 to 24/8, rain is expected to continue, with no hot weather anticipated.
